Eligibility and Requirements in 92341, California

To qualify for a reverse mortgage in the 92341 Zip Code, California, you generally need to meet specific criteria designed to ensure you can benefit from this loan option. First, the primary requirement is that you must be at least 62 years of age, as reverse mortgages are intended for eligible seniors. This age threshold helps protect borrowers and aligns with federal guidelines.

Regarding home type, your property must be your primary residence, and it typically includes single-family homes, certain multi-unit properties, or approved condominiums. However, not all home types qualify, so it’s important to verify details based on your situation. Additionally, you must have a substantial amount of equity in your home—often at least 50%—which means the loan amount you can access depends on your home’s appraised value minus any existing mortgages or liens.

Financial assessments are a key part of the process. Lenders, including our team at Summit Lending, will review your ability to continue paying for property taxes, homeowners insurance, and home maintenance to ensure long-term viability. This assessment helps prevent potential defaults and safeguards your equity.

In California, state-specific regulations may apply, such as mandatory counseling from a HUD-approved agency to educate you on the implications of a reverse mortgage. Important Considerations in 92341, California

When exploring Reverse Mortgage Loans in the 92341 Zip Code, it's essential to evaluate several key factors that could impact your decision. These considerations help ensure that this financial option aligns with your long-term goals and circumstances.

First, consider the impact on heirs. A reverse mortgage converts part of your home equity into cash, which must be repaid when you pass away or permanently leave the home. This could reduce the inheritance for your heirs, as the loan balance plus interest might need to be settled from the property's sale proceeds. Next, be aware of the potential fees involved. Reverse mortgages often include costs such as origination fees, servicing fees, and mortgage insurance premiums. These can vary, so it's wise to review them carefully. For personalized estimates, you can use our Loan Calculator to get a better sense of your financial obligations. Another critical aspect is maintaining property taxes and insurance. As a borrower, you must continue to pay these expenses; failure to do so could result in the loan becoming due or even foreclosure. Staying current on these obligations is vital to protect your investment and ensure the longevity of your reverse mortgage.

Finally, examine local market conditions that could affect home values in the 92341 area. Factors like real estate trends in San Bernardino County might influence property appreciation or depreciation, impacting the equity in your home.
